Reputable vs. Illegal Mileage Correction.
While commonly associated with frauds, mileage correction can be legitimate in certain situations:.
Instrument Collection Substitute: If the tool cluster stops working and is replaced, the brand-new cluster will likely begin at absolutely no miles. To show the automobile's actual mileage, the brand-new cluster requires to be set with the correct worth.
ECU Substitute: Comparable to the instrument cluster, if the ECU is changed, the mileage data may need to be synchronized.
Clerical Mistakes: In uncommon instances, errors can happen throughout lorry registration or maintenance, resulting in wrong mileage recordings. Correction could be necessary to correct these errors.
However, the primary reason for mileage correction is usually illegal. Unscrupulous vendors might attempt to " curtail" the odometer to make a car show up more recent and less utilized, hence commanding a higher cost. This is prohibited in many jurisdictions and is a significant kind of fraudulence. Identifying Mileage Fraudulence.
Identifying mileage tampering can be difficult, yet there are some warnings to watch out for:.
Incongruities in Service Records: Look for spaces in the solution background or incongruities in the mileage reported at various service periods.
Damage vs. Mileage: Examine the lorry's problem. Excessive deterioration on the inside, outside, or mechanical elements contrasted to the reported mileage can be a indicator of meddling. This is specifically essential with deluxe brands like Mercedes-Benz, where the interior ought to mirror the relatively lower mileage.
Misaligned Figures on the Odometer: While much less usual with electronic odometers, misaligned numbers on analog odometers can be a indicator of tampering.
Inspect Automobile History Records: Provider like Carfax or AutoCheck can provide vehicle background reports, consisting of mileage documents. Disparities in these reports can show mileage scams.
